Transaction 3c0176e59cac09a2288b7998c442ecf96f4aea78b8a7fde8e7abcdc95da0d358

1 Input
2 Outputs
  • 3c0176e59cac09a2288b7998c442ecf96f4aea78b8a7fde8e7abcdc95da0d358:0
  • value  234000
    address  3HDG1dUeoFsKJ4ob1SJaggjikDuWZs4Qxy
  • 3c0176e59cac09a2288b7998c442ecf96f4aea78b8a7fde8e7abcdc95da0d358:1
  • value  146537423
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C